Stantec is looking for a Senior Application Architect that will be responsible for designing and overseeing the architecture of various software systems. The Senior Application Architect role ensures that applications (both cloud-based and on-premises) are scalable, secure, and integrated with existing systems, including our Oracle EBS ERP platform. They will work closely with our Custom Software Solutions development team, global database administrators and business stakeholders/SMEs (Subject Matter Experts) to translate business requirements into technical solutions, and guide projects through to successful implementation.
The initial focus of the role will be to work with business stakeholders/SMEs to optimize workflows and business processes between our Project Managers and Project Accountants (aka PM2PA). This will involve enhancing and integrating numerous existing applications and data stores, including our on-premises Oracle E-Business Suite, and in the future, Oracle Fusion Cloud apps.
Key Responsibilities- Design and Architecture:
Design and document the overall application architecture for projects, spanning on-premises systems and cloud platforms. Ensure architectures are scalable, reliable, and meet business requirements. Create strategies for integrating cloud services with existing systems (e.g., ensuring new cloud applications interface smoothly with Oracle EBS). Analyze current application portfolios and identify opportunities to improve or modernize them (e.g., recommending which systems to migrate to cloud or how to refactor legacy EBS custom applications). - Cloud & Infrastructure:
Provide expertise in cloud services (such as Oracle and/or Azure) and architect cloud-based applications or migrations. Ensure all cloud solutions follow security and compliance requirements. Design microservices-based systems on Azure that integrate with on-premises Oracle databases, adhering to cloud provider best practices and internal guidelines. - Oracle EBS Integration:
Serve as the subject matter expert on Oracle E-Business Suite (EBS) within the architecture. Ensure that new and existing applications integrate seamlessly with Oracle EBS where necessary (e.g., Financial or Project Accounting systems interfacing with Oracle EBS). Provide guidance on Oracle EBS enhancements and customizations, ensuring they are done in line with best practices to maintain system stability and up gradability.
Design APIs or middleware for data exchange between Oracle EBS and existing applications, cloud applications, or advising on Oracle EBS configuration to support new business requirements. - Technical Leadership:
Provide technical leadership to software development teams throughout the software development lifecycle. Lead architecture review sessions and code reviews, mentor developers, and act as a bridge to the custom software development team to communicate architectural decisions and rationale. Ensure adherence to design principles and patterns (e.g., modular design, microservices, event-driven architecture). - Performance, Security & Compliance:
Incorporate security requirements and performance considerations into all architecture designs. Ensure applications adhere to security best practices and relevant compliance standards. Work with IT Security to perform risk assessments and include data protection controls and robust error handling. Design for high performance and availability with load balancing, caching, and failover mechanisms. Ensure reliability, maintainability, and disaster recovery preparedness. - Stakeholder
Collaboration:
Collaborate with stakeholders across the organization to understand requirements and translate them into technical designs. Participate in requirement-gathering workshops and liaise with vendors or external partners when third-party systems or cloud services are involved. - Project Involvement:
Participate in IT project planning as the architecture owner. Estimate effort and resources for architectural tasks, monitor progress, and intervene if refactoring is needed. May lead proof-of-concept initiatives and ensure proper architectural documentation for future reference and onboarding. - Continuous Improvement:
Stay updated with emerging technologies, cloud innovations, Dev Sec Ops tools, and Oracle EBS features. Drive adoption of new technologies and establish internal best practices and technical standards.
